Job Description
You will provide support, guidance, and direction to Front Office teams and other colleagues, ensuring the standard of credit applications is consistent and of a high quality.
What you’ll be doing.
- Analyzing transactions across the UK and Continental European jurisdictions
- Providing constructive support to Front Office with the objective of structuring transactions to meet acceptable risk parameters and deliver financial targets
- Supporting the production of succinct and well-informed presentations of propositions to the relevant credit approval authority.
- Monitoring a portfolio of names, seeking approval for waiver requests/annual reviews and identifying and escalating to senior management issues causing concern.
- Supporting the Credit Risk Head of LBOs Europe with any regulatory requirements including regulatory capital model development and monitoring processes across 1LoD and 2LoD.
- Relevant experience of analyzing corporate banking credits with good documentary skills.
- Solid understanding of financial forecasting methodology and credit rating interpretation.
